本文目录导读:
随着信息技术的飞速发展,数据已经成为企业和社会不可或缺的重要资源,而分布式存储作为数据中心的核心组成部分,承载着海量数据的存储、管理和访问任务,分布式存储究竟是什么?它又是如何发挥作用的呢?本文将深入探讨分布式存储的定义、原理、应用场景及其在未来数据中心建设中的重要性。
分布式存储的定义
分布式存储是一种将数据分散存储在多个物理节点上的存储架构,这些物理节点可以是服务器、磁盘阵列、固态硬盘等,通过高速网络连接在一起,形成一个统一的存储系统,与传统的集中式存储相比,分布式存储具有更高的可靠性、可扩展性和性能。
分布式存储的原理
分布式存储的核心原理是数据分片(Sharding)和冗余存储(Replication),数据分片是指将一个大文件切割成多个小文件,分别存储在不同的物理节点上,冗余存储则是指在同一物理节点上或不同物理节点上保留数据的多个副本,以实现数据的可靠性和高可用性。
图片来源于网络,如有侵权联系删除
分布式存储的原理如下:
1、数据分片:将数据按照一定的规则进行分片,例如按时间、按用户、按业务类型等,每个分片存储在某个特定的物理节点上。
2、数据复制:将每个分片复制到多个物理节点上,以实现数据的冗余存储,复制策略可以是多副本复制,也可以是奇偶校验复制。
3、数据访问:用户通过访问任何一个物理节点,即可获取到所需的数据,分布式存储系统会自动进行数据定位和路由,确保用户能够快速访问到所需数据。
4、数据一致性:分布式存储系统通过一致性算法(如Paxos、Raft等)确保数据在不同物理节点上的一致性。
分布式存储的应用场景
分布式存储在各个领域都有广泛的应用,以下列举几个典型场景:
图片来源于网络,如有侵权联系删除
1、大数据:随着大数据时代的到来,分布式存储成为处理海量数据的基石,Hadoop、Spark等大数据处理框架都采用分布式存储来存储和处理数据。
2、云计算:云计算平台需要存储大量用户数据和应用程序,分布式存储提供了一种高效、可靠的数据存储解决方案。
3、人工智能:人工智能应用需要处理大量图像、视频和文本数据,分布式存储能够满足这些应用对数据存储和处理的需求。
4、物联网:物联网设备产生的海量数据需要存储和管理,分布式存储为物联网应用提供了可靠的数据存储平台。
分布式存储的未来发展趋势
随着技术的不断发展,分布式存储在未来将呈现以下发展趋势:
1、高性能:分布式存储系统将不断优化数据访问和传输性能,以满足日益增长的数据处理需求。
图片来源于网络,如有侵权联系删除
2、高可靠性:通过改进数据复制、一致性算法等技术,提高分布式存储的可靠性,确保数据安全。
3、智能化:结合人工智能技术,实现分布式存储的自动化运维、故障预测和性能优化。
4、轻量化:随着云计算和边缘计算的兴起,分布式存储将更加轻量化,以适应多样化的应用场景。
分布式存储作为数据中心的核心组成部分,在数据存储、管理和访问方面发挥着重要作用,随着技术的不断进步,分布式存储将在未来数据中心建设中扮演更加重要的角色。
标签: #分布式存储是干什么的
评论列表